Glendale Technology High School is a government-funded co-educational comprehensive secondary day school in , Australia. Established in 1970 as Glendale High School, the school enrolled approximately 802 students in 2025, from Year 7 to Year 12, of whom 17 percent identified as Indigenous Australians and nine percent were from a language background other than English. is situated 1½ km southeast of Glendale High School.
